Provident Financial Holdings, Inc. (NASDAQ:PROV - Get Free Report) shares crossed above its two hundred day moving average during trading on Friday . The stock has a two hundred day moving average of $16.88 and traded as high as $18.12. Provident Financial shares last traded at $17.98, with a volume of 6,600 shares trading hands.

Provident Financial Price Performance
The stock has a market cap of $112.38 million, a price-to-earnings ratio of 17.46 and a beta of 0.33. The company has a quick ratio of 1.20, a current ratio of 1.20 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.45. The company's 50-day moving average is $17.43 and its 200-day moving average is $16.88.
Provident Financial (NASDAQ:PROV -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, July 28th. The financial services provider reported $0.35 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.29 by $0.06. The company had revenue of $15.22 million for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$10.00 million. Provident Financial had a return on equity of 5.22% and a net margin of 11.16%. Equities research analysts expect that Provident Financial Holdings, Inc. will post 1.22 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.
Provident Financial Dividend Announcement
The business also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, September 3rd. Shareholders of record on Thursday, August 13th will be issued a dividend of $0.14 per share.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Thursday, August 13th. This represents a $0.56 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 3.1%. Provident Financial's dividend payout ratio (DPR) is presently 54.37%.
Insider Activity at Provident Financial
In other news, SVP David Weiant sold 2,732 shares of the company's stock in a transaction dated Wednesday, June 10th. The shares were sold at an average price of $17.12, for a total value of $46,771.84. Following the sale, the senior vice president owned 6,175 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$105,716. This represents a 30.67% decrease in their position. The transaction was disclosed in a document filed with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is available through the SEC website. In the last 90 days, insiders have sold 4,744 shares of company stock valued at $81,076. 11.49% of the stock is currently owned by insiders.

About Provident Financial

Provident Financial Services, Inc NASDAQ: PROV is a bank holding company headquartered in Jersey City, New Jersey, that conducts its operations through its wholly owned subsidiary, Provident Bank. With origins dating back to 1839, the company has grown into a full-service financial institution offering a broad spectrum of products and services to individuals, small businesses and commercial clients.
The company's principal business activities include retail banking, commercial lending, mortgage finance and wealth management.
